HomeMy WebLinkAbout1986-136-08/19/1986-OLD POWER PLANT POUDRE RIVER TRUST RENEW LEASE RESOLUTION 86- 136 OF TH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F FORT COLLINS AUTHORIZING THE CITY MANAGER TO ENTER INTO AN AGREEMENT TO RENEW THE LEASE OF THE OLD POWER PLANT TO THE POUDRE RIVER TRUST WHEREAS, the Council of the City of Fort Collins has authorized the Poudre River Trust (the "Trust") to work toward the improvement of the Poudre River area; and WHEREAS, the Trust has determined that the use of the old City Power Plant as a visual arts center is its priority project; and WHEREAS, Resolution 85-31 authorized the lease of the Power Plant to the Trust for a period of 18 months to use the Power Plant as a visual arts center and the Trust now wishes to continue leasing the Power Plant from the City for an additional two years; and WHEREAS, the City Council has determined that use of the Power Plant by the Trust is in the public interest and will be a benefit to the community.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F FORT COLLINS that the City Manager is hereby authorized to extend the lease with the Poudre River Trust to allow it to use and to sublease the Power Plant for office space and other uses as it determines to be in the best interests of the community. The lease provisions will include, without limitation, the following: 1 . The term of said lease will be for not more than 24 months. 2. The City will receive a nominal lease payment of $1 and the Trust will be responsible for a proportionate share of the utility costs for the Power Plant.
